§ 864.7400 - Hemoglobin A2 assay.

(a) Identification. A hemoglobin A2 assay is a device used to determine the hemoglobin A2 content of human blood. The measurement of hemoglobin A2 is used in the diagnosis of the thalassemias (hereditary hemolytic anemias characterized by decreased synthesis of one or more types of hemoglobin polypeptide chains).

(b) Classification. Class II (performance standards).
